Glaucoma is a progressive optic nerve neuropathy that leads to considerable visual disturbances over time. In order to keep the rate of progression as low as possible, we need to consider many different aspects that directly and indirectly affect progression of glaucoma. Over 16 chapters, distinguished authors shed light on the multifaceted scope of glaucoma progression and make many valuable recommendations on the difficult task of dealing with this.
